Working Principles

The S-1701F3026-U5T1G is a linear voltage regulator that utilizes a pass transistor to regulate the output voltage. It compares the reference voltage with the feedback voltage and adjusts the pass transistor accordingly to maintain a stable output voltage. The dropout voltage is minimized by using a low resistance pass transistor, allowing efficient regulation even when the input voltage is close to the desired output voltage.
